I can thank whoever shipped the tailights to me because when I recieved them the left tailight was chipped and the left white reverse light never worked so I had to take out the wiring harness from my stock tailights and put in the ones I got from RRM. My stock harness had only three bulbs but the RRM lights have 4. I might just buy some all new tailights and go with a new look or make my own harness for cheaper idk. As far as my center console is concerned the paint is chipping away a little.
